我对Java相当陌生,而且我在使用Swing时遇到了一些困难。我正在尝试创建一个非常简单的GUI程序,应该是创建一组按钮,但我的代码不工作。
这是我的代码;
myPanel = new JPanel();
JButton myButton = new JButton("create buttons");
myButton.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ent e) {
int val = Integer.parseInt(text
在我的例子中,在设置我的应用程序时,我点击按钮更新db,它向我显示dialogFragment的进度,如果我点击主页按钮-我的应用程序崩溃。
日志错误:
java.lang.IllegalStateException: Can not perform this action after onSaveInstanceState
at android.support.v4.app.FragmentManagerImpl.checkStateLoss(Fra
我的JButton ActionListener有点问题。我在另一个类中定义了一个doTheCleaning()方法,当调用它时,会对我的图形用户界面进行一系列更改。
public void doTheCleaning(){
//change image icon
//had thread.sleep here
//insert to text area
//had thread.sleep here
//etc
}
然后在另一个类中,我实例化了包含doTheCleaning()方法的类,并使用ActionListener ()方法为我的jbutton编
无法在Jenkins 2.249.3版本中安装Veracode扫描插件
Failure -
java.net.SocketTimeoutException: Read timed out
at java.net.SocketInputStream.socketRead0(Native Method)
at java.net.SocketInputStream.socketRead(SocketInputStream.java:116)
at java.net.SocketInputStream.read(SocketInputStream.java:171)
at java.net.S
我正尝试在JavaFX中创建一个简单的加载窗口,并为此使用了一个信息提示。下面是我的代码:
public Alert alert = new Alert(Alert.AlertType.INFORMATION);
public void drawData(javafx.event.ActionEvent actionEvent) {
alert.setHeaderText(null);
alert.setTitle("Loading...");
alert.show();
for (int i = 0; i < * something *
我制作了一个java GUI程序,并在该GUI上添加了一个jList,以便通过调用以下命令添加一个项目,从而在该jList上打印程序的输出
listBox.addElement(""); // where listBox is an instance of jList
但问题是,这些项目在添加时并未显示。它们是在程序即将结束时显示的。
意思是,我通过点击"Start“按钮来启动程序,然后整个过程就完成了,包括向"listBox”添加项目,但当程序返回到"Start“按钮的jList的"actionPerformed()”方法时,这些项目就会显示在
我正在尝试更改单选按钮和墨迹波纹的颜色。覆盖单独的CSS选择器是痛苦的,而且容易出错。我甚至不想在我的应用程序的单选按钮中添加"md-primary“或"md-accent”类。我想覆盖默认主题。我搜索了文档,搜索了谷歌,所以,Angular Material GitHub和演示页面,但找不到简单问题的答案:
单选按钮使用默认主题的哪个调色板?
我已经在JMenuItem中放置了一个图标。我想在单击JMenuItem时在JLabel上显示此图标,如何实现? 这是我的代码: /*
* To change this license header, choose License Headers in Project Properties.
* To change this template file, choose Tools | Templates
* and open the template in the editor.
*/
package labwork5;
/**
*
* @author haseeb shah
我只是偶尔从用户设备上得到崩溃报告。它发生在AysncTask doInBackground()上,但让我感到奇怪的是,它发生的那一行只在活动(ActivityY)的第1行。那里有什么可能是空的?我该如何调试它?我不知道这是否相关,但它似乎只发生在AsyncTask$2。
java.lang.RuntimeException: An error occured while executing doInBackground()
at android.os.AsyncTask$3.done(AsyncTask.java:300)
at java.util.concurrent.Futu
我使用计时器类每2分钟执行一次函数。
我的TimerMethod中的代码失败了,但是当它是onCreat的一部分时,它完美地工作了。我确实注意到它在更新布局中的文本字段时失败了。
代码如下:
public class MeetingManager extends ListActivity {
private static final String TAG = "MyApp";
public static final String PREFS_NAME = "MyAppData";
private Timer myTimer;
我有一个在图形用户界面设计器设计的表单。我称它为“注册”,为新会员注册收集信息。当我尝试使用showForm(“注册”,null)打开这个表单时,我得到了这个错误-
java.lang.NullPointerException
at java.util.Hashtable.put(Hashtable.java:394)
at com.codename1.ui.util.UIBuilder.getFormState(UIBuilder.java:1711)
at com.codename1.ui.util.UIBuilder.showForm(UIBuilder.java